The Garuda Purana is one of the 18 Mahapuranas in Hinduism, structured as a dialogue between Lord Vishnu and Garuda (the King of Birds). It focuses heavily on life after death, the soul's journey, reincarnation, and funeral rites. It acts as a guide to the afterlife, detailing hell, heaven, and karma.
Key Themes and Teachings:
The Journey After Death: Describes the soul's departure from the body, the perilous journey to Yamaloka (the city of death), and the judgment of souls.
Karma and Rebirth: Emphasizes that actions (Karma) in life determine the soul\'s next incarnation or its experience in hell (punishment) or heaven.
28 Hells and Rewards: The text outlines various punishments for sins and rewards for virtuous acts.
Rituals and Cremation: Explains the importance of funeral rites, funeral, and rites for the deceased (pretas) to help the soul transition.
Life and Health: Besides afterlife, it covers Ayurveda, medicine, gemology, and proper conduct, making it a guide for a righteous life.
